M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Applicants must meet
all minimum (and selective) qualifications to be considered, and to appear on
the list of people eligible for hire. Please read all requirements before
applying.
Experience: Four years of professional contract management
experience or professional procurement experience and Two years of experience
in contract management or procurement involving duties such as: soliciting,
evaluating, negotiating and awarding contracts and ensuring compliance with
governmental procurement laws, regulations and conditions.
Notes:
1. Candidates may substitute the possession of a Bachelor’s
degree from an accredited college or university and Two years of experience in
contract management or procurement involving duties such as: soliciting,
evaluating, negotiating and awarding contracts and ensuring compliance with
governmental procurement laws, regulations and conditions for the required
experience.
2. Candidates may substitute certification as a Certified
Public Manager from the National Association of Purchasing Management;
Certified Professional Contracts Manager from the National Contract Management
Association; Certified Public Purchasing Officer or Certified Professional
Public Buyer from the Universal Public Purchasing Certification Council
(National Institute of Governmental Purchasing, Inc. or National Association of
State Purchasing Officers) for four years of the required experience.
3. Candidates may substitute additional graduate education
at an accredited college or university, at the rate of thirty credit hours for
each year of the required experience.
4.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ed Forces military
service experience as a commissioned officer in Contracting, Industrial
Management or logistics specialist classifications or administrative support
specialty codes in the procurement or financial management fields of work on a
year-for-year basis for the required experience.

L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S AND CERTIFICATIONS
1. Employees in this classification may be assigned duties which require the operation of a motor vehicle. Employees assigned such duties will be required to possess a motor vehicle operator’s license valid in the State of Maryland.
2. Employees in this classification who have not done so already must obtain and possess certification as a Procurement Professional from the Maryland Department of General Services within one year of appointment.
